Research Conference – April 28 & 29, 2014
Conference Webcast
The Sustainable Prosperity research-policy network is bringing together some of the world’s pre-eminent environment & economy thinkers for a two day research conference to share knowledge and think big about Policy Innovation for Greening Growth.
Join us online Monday, April 28 & Tuesday April 29 for fascinating panels, inspiring keynotes & powerful conversation.
Marianne Fay, World Bank, Chief Economist, Sustainable Development & Climate Change
Jeremy Oppenheim, McKinsey, and Global Commission on the Economy and Climate
Geoffrey Heal, Columbia, and Earth Institute
Kathryn Harrison, UBC
James Meadowcroft, Carleton (CRC)
Matthew Kahn, UCLA
Vic Adamowicz, Alberta
Richard Lipsey, SFU
Anne Dale, Royal Roads (CRC)
Peter Nicholson, Council of Can. Academies
Ed Barbier, Wyoming, and author of New Blueprint for a Green Economy
